Introducing the ACBRD

The ACBRD is the first national research centre worldwide dedicated to investigating the behavioural, psychological and social aspects of living with diabetes. Established in 2010 as a partnership for better health between Diabetes Victoria and Deakin University, the ACBRD has pioneered research in many areas.  

The ACBRD has become the world’s leading centre focused on diabetes stigma research. Their research shows that stigma negatively impacts on the health and self-care of people living with all types of diabetes. Diabetes stigma also affects the professional and social opportunities of adults and children living with diabetes.  

Recently, the ACBRD led an international consensus on recommendations to end diabetes stigma. The heart of the consensus is the Pledge, which was launched on World Diabetes Day 2023. The Pledge is a commitment to proactively bring an end to diabetes stigma and discrimination.

It has received more than 2,700 signatures from individuals, organisations in more than 100 countries across the world. The ACBRD’s impact is truly impact, and the team is only just getting started.
